On February 5, the Presnensky court of Moscow extended house arrest by the former head of the branch maternity hospital at the State Clinical Hospital named after S.I. Spasokukotsky (former maternity hospital No. 27) to Marina Sarmosyan until March 17. A decision was made to dismiss Sarmosyan and the heads of all departments based on the results of an internal audit, the capital Department of Health said on December 6 last year. The department indicated the revealed “improper performance of official duties” as a reason. The IC charged Sarmosyan with negligence (Article 293 of the Criminal Code of the Russian Federation) and the provision of services that did not meet security requirements (Article 238 of the Criminal Code of the Russian Federation), and on December 8, the court sent a doctor with more than 20 years of experience to two months in jail. Later, the measure of restraint was changed to house arrest.

Cesarean section

“I had a rather large fruit. When concluding a contract with a doctor, we agreed that we would not risk it and for any deviations we would go for surgery. However, during childbirth, all my requests were ignored. As a result, I had to give birth in a natural way, even when it became clear that the baby turned incorrectly, which is dangerous and threatens with birth injuries. I am sure that the doctors refused a cesarean section so as not to spoil the statistics. Maternity hospital No. 27 has a high percentage of natural births. This is considered a good indicator. And for superfluous cesarean, the manager understands with obstetricians, ”Tatyana Bengraf told RT about her version of the incident.

Other women in labor who wrote the statement agree with the opinion of the Muscovite. Women are sure that if they had a cesarean section, then complications could have been avoided.

However, RT doctors interviewed by doctors do not share the position of women in labor.

“Doctors don't make decisions just like that. For different cases, there are clinical recommendations. Same thing with cesarean section. Women do not have surgery just at will. There are indicators at which a cesarean section is performed. If a woman does not gain the necessary indicators, then she gives birth herself, ”explained Lyubov Erofeeva, obstetrician-gynecologist, expert of the World Health Organization, RT.

“If labor has begun, then a cesarean section can only be done at the very beginning. If the head has already lowered down, then the operation cannot be performed, the woman will have to give birth to the end, ”added the obstetrician-gynecologist of the Scientific Center for Obstetrics, Gynecology and Perinatology named after Academician V.I. Kulakova Julia Kubitskaya.

Apparently, Bengraf did just that. At first, there was not enough evidence for Caesarean, and when the child, as Tatyana says, “turned a little wrong,” it was too late to operate.

But could doctors initially make a decision not to spoil the statistics (according to the UK, in the 27th maternity hospital, 13% of deliveries occur in a caesarean hospital, and 30% on average in Moscow)? Experts do not believe this. Indeed, a large proportion of natural births in the 27th maternity hospital is the result of how the system of maternity hospitals in Moscow is organized. They are divided into three categories in the capital.

The first category includes large perinatal centers where doctors are ready to take the most complex births and deal with pathologies in infants.

The second category is the maternity hospital with large hospital complexes. Here they are ready to take a difficult birth, but nevertheless the treatment of pathologies in infants is not a clinic profile.

Third category: detached maternity hospital.

Maternity hospital at the State Clinical Hospital named after S.I. Spasokukotsky (which everyone continues to call the 27th maternity hospital from old memory) belongs to the second category.

“If the doctor foresees complications during childbirth, he is very likely to send the expectant mother to the perinatal center. Therefore, it turns out that in places where the best equipment is narrow specialists, most operations are carried out and infants are more likely to find diseases. And in separate maternity hospitals there are good statistics of natural births, because mothers who have no difficulties are expected to go there, ”Yerofeyeva explained.

The expert added that Moscow should not be taken as a statistical example at all. Women in labor from all over the country come with complicated cases.

Abdominal pressure

This is the scariest detail in the scandal with the former 27th hospital. Doctors, according to Tatyana Bengraf, during difficult births with their hands pressed on the stomach, literally pushing the baby out of the mother. She is sure that because of this, her child became disabled.

What could be rational reasons for such rude actions? Perhaps here lies a medical error?

“Attempts have been going on for at least 40 minutes, when it became clear that the child is not moving forward. I was denied a cesarean section and began to put pressure on my stomach to squeeze the child out. They looked at the CTG apparatus (cardiotocography, shows the baby's heartbeat. - RT ) and squeezed out during the fight. This happened 5-6 times in 10-15 minutes. The pressure didn’t help - the child who got stuck in the birth canal had a heartbeat. Then the doctor, using a vacuum extractor, pulled the child by the head. She wheezed and died, there was no heartbeat, ”Tatyana Bengraf told RT.

The girl was resuscitated.

  • © Photo from the personal archive

The obstetrician-gynecologist Lyubov Erofeeva, whom we asked to comment on the actions of her colleagues, explained that such actions are called "obstetric aggression."

“Pressure on the abdomen during childbirth was prohibited back in the early 90s because of the high risk of injuring the baby,” Erofeeva says. “But why did the doctors do this now?” This is an extreme measure in difficult births. It happens that doctors used all available methods, medications did not help, labor is weak, the child has been standing in a certain position for a long time, and you can’t do a cesarean section. Then doctors can press on the bottom of the uterus to help the baby move. This is a risk that a doctor can rarely take. ”

The problem is that if the natural birth cannot end in any way, then the doctors do not have many “legal” methods. The child needs to be taken out somehow and now they use vacuum extraction for this (they refused the obstetric forceps with which the fetus is pulled by the head) almost everywhere. A suction cup is inserted into the uterus, which is tightly pressed to the baby's head to create negative pressure between it and the cup of the device, and then the doctor carefully pulls out the baby. In some cases, an episiotomy is also performed (a perineum is cut with a scalpel to a woman). So in the end they did with Tatyana Bengraf. But vacuum extraction is also a risk. The child is not protected from injury.

According to obstetrician-gynecologist Julia Kubitskaya, the success of childbirth is only 50% dependent on the actions of doctors. The nature and health of the mother are no less important than all modern medicine.

Obstetrician-gynecologist Lyubov Erofeeva generally believes that success depends on the doctor during childbirth only by 20-30%.

“It so happens that pregnancy is going well, and deliveries are not easy. Doctors do not have much information about the condition of the child before childbirth: we know his heartbeat, we can evaluate movement, muscles, bones. But that’s all. There is always a risk during childbirth, ”says Erofeeva.

In Russia, 31.5% of newborns fall ill or are born sick (data from the Ministry of Health for 2018, meaning full-term and premature babies weighing more than 1 kg). In the statistics of the ministry, a table listing the diseases of infants occupies sheet A4. But, for example, “cerebral status disorders”, like Tatyana Bengraf’s daughter, occur in 6% of cases. The death of newborns in obstetric units occurred in 0.1% of cases. Moreover, directly from birth injuries, they died in 0.001% of cases.

“In my experience, in most cases after a difficult birth, the parents blame the doctors for everything. On the forums on the Internet there are many stories about the alleged mistakes of obstetricians. I can say for sure: often doctors are unfoundedly accused of doctors, ”said Lyubov Erofeeva, obstetrician-gynecologist.

A comprehensive forensic examination should distinguish a true medical error from a statistically probable injury to a newborn. It is still not posted. So far there is only the testimony of parents who, not being experts, blame the doctors for everything, as well as the testimonies of doctors who, while denying their guilt, may try to cover up the mistake.

Why was Sarmosyan arrested?

Tatyana Bengraf and other parents of the affected children more than once during the summer of 2019 complained about the actions of obstetricians of the maternity hospital at the State Clinical Hospital named after S.I. Spasokukotsky. The Department of Health and Roszdravnadzor conducted checks on the actions of doctors. In a conversation with RT, Tatyana Bengraf stated that she received “formal replies” from officials based on these checks.

Kirill Yudin received a response from the Department of Health (RT has a copy), which says that doctors are innocent of the meningitis of his son. The insurance company, at the insistence of Yudin, checked the treatment of the child.

The expert’s conclusion is contradictory: “the quality of the medical care provided is inadequate”, but at the same time “the defect in medical care did not affect the health status of the insured person”.

Marina Sarmosyan’s lawyer Gevorg Dangyan agreed to read part of the conclusion of the examination of Roszdravnadzor without handing the document to the RT correspondent: “When assisting, there were no medical errors that could have a direct causal relationship with the illness and complication of the child (Olivia, daughter Bengraf. - RT ). "

The lawyer said that the examination of Roszdravnadzor still mentioned shortcomings in the work of obstetricians of the former 27th hospital. There were questions about the hypothermia procedure - after giving birth, Olivia’s head was covered with ice in order to reduce the possible damage to the nervous system from a difficult birth.

Be that as it may, the inspection of Roszdravnadzor on the complaint of Tatyana Bengraf was held in April 2019. But Marina Sarmosyan lost her job much later, after the appearance of Tatyana's post - she wrote it in late November (the dismissal took place, recall, in early December). Moreover, the criminal case, according to Bengraf herself, was opened on October 14. Apparently, they said goodbye to Sarmosyan because of a wide public outcry.
